Constraints and Suggestions Regarding Women Self Help Groups in Surguja District Chhattisgarh State

Abstract

The following study was conducted during the year 201516 in the Surguja district of the Chhattisgarh state. There are 7 blocks in Surguja district. Out of these, Ambikapur block was selected purposively for this study. Firstly, 15 SHGs were selected by using simple random sampling procedure. Then, from each selected SHGs, 10 women members were to be selected. Therefore, total 150 respondents (10×15=150) were considered for this study. This study further revealed that under the Personal constraints, (74.67%) of respondents reported lack of education. Majority of the respondents in Economic constraints reported less amount of subsidy (69.33%). Majority of the respondents (78.67%) in Technical constraints reported less organization of training programme well in time. Majority of the respondents (72.00%) in Communicational constraints reported less contact with the extension personnel as the main reason. The other major constraints faced by the members were lack of leadership quality in SHGs members (45.33%). Some of the key suggestions given by the members for improving the technological performance in various activities that training programmes should be organized frequently and well in time.
